Default RE: TCSTD...Need your advice

SeII's, good choice IMO. I also have them on mine.
No download required for JUST mufflers.
High flow air kit, needs download even if it is JUST the air kit installed. Both muffs & a/f kit, you need the download.
Tuner kit??...Download??? You need one or the other, tuner kit is for a carb model (jets etc.), download is for fuel injection.

You did right if you're happy with it.

If you got the mufflers, air cleaner kit, and download (fuel injection) you did right.You'll pick up about 9 HP there.

As far as price, they vary so much from dealer to dealer, I couldn't even take a shot here. In my area the labor is $95 an hour, other places are $65 an hour. Maybe around 2 - 2 1/2 hours labor for the install of all parts. Very little setup here, download and go.

Default RE: TCSTD...Need your advice

Hi Jimmy,
I had a custom Dyno PC map built for my 06 Heritage 88B with stage 1 and V&H Big Shot Staggered. 78.8hp and a 10ftlb gain in torque
Your welcome to it.
I saved the original from the Dyno and made another copy adding fuel to the 0% Throttle position cells from 1000rpm through 4000rpm. This got rid of alot of the Decel Pop when the throttle is closed.
Your welcome to both.

You don't need a fuel manager to run an aftermarket exhaust, although you may notice an increase in decel popping. A fuel manager is required when the air flow is increased from stock.
I'm no expert, just sharing my experience.
